Islamabad : Roots International Schools (RIS) and Colleges celebrated International Women’s Day with full zeal and zest, says a press release.
Speeches were held throughout campuses, cakes were cut, women were acknowledged and students were briefed about the significance of the day. RIS has always preached and incorporated women empowerment and gender equality into its values and principles. During the cake cutting ceremony while talking to the audience Sir Walid Mushtaq said, ‘Keep up doing the great work women, you are very instrumental for our country’s growth and success. Salutations to brave women of the world who against the challenges in their lives continue to inspire new generations to come. You are role models to all children around the globe. Keep up the brave work.’
